> On 9/29/20 11:29 AM, Patrick Fu wrote:
> > When async register/unregister function is invoked in certain vhost
> > event callbacks (e.g. vring state change), deadlock may occur due to
> > recursive spinlock acquire. This patch removes unnecessary spinlock
> > from register API and use trylock() primitive in the unregister API
> > to avoid deadlock.
> 
> I am not convinced it is unnecessary in every cases.

> What if a virtqueue is being destroyed while this function is called?
> 

Yes, this is a scenario that access_lock may help. I will add spinlock back in v4.
